Stunning Gwynedd gold artefact among priceless Bronze Age items stolen

DETAILS have been released of priceless items that were stolen from a Welsh museum, including a gold artefact from Gwynedd.
Police are investigating after the theft from St Fagans National Museum of history in Cardiff in October.
Two men have been charged with burglary and have been remanded in custody, as efforts to trace the items continue.
A South Wales Police statement said: "We continue to investigate a burglary at St Fagans National Museum of History, Cardiff.
"Gavin Burnett, 43, and Darren Burnett, 50, both from Northampton, have been charged with burglary and are remanded in custody.
"Items of Bronze Age gold jewellery were stolen from a display case in the museum's main building at around 12.30am on Monday, October 6.
